Govt to Hold Open House on Steel Import Issues on April 27

Apr 22 (BNP): The Government is set to conduct an Open House session on April 27 to address concerns related to steel imports, bringing together key stakeholders from the industry, trade bodies, and policymakers.

The meeting is expected to focus on rising import pressures, pricing trends, and the impact of global steel supply dynamics on domestic producers. Industry participants are likely to present their views on competitiveness, demand conditions, and possible policy measures to ensure stability in the sector.

The Open House initiative is seen as part of the government’s broader effort to engage directly with industry stakeholders and develop a balanced approach that supports both domestic manufacturing and market requirements.

Steel remains a critical sector for infrastructure, construction, and manufacturing, and any policy discussion around imports is expected to have wide-ranging implications for pricing, supply chains, and industrial growth.

The session is likely to play an important role in shaping future decisions aimed at strengthening India’s steel ecosystem while addressing concerns over import dependency and market fluctuations.
